  • Sales Associate

    Sales Associates are responsible for assisting customers with product selection, providing technical information, and processing transactions. These individuals require a comprehensive understanding of the store’s inventory and a commitment to delivering exceptional customer service. For Home Depot jobs in Tooele, the Sales Associate role is often the most readily available entry point.

  • Specialty Sales

    Specialty sales positions, such as those in departments like paint, flooring, or appliances, require specialized knowledge and a deeper understanding of product applications. Employees in these roles guide customers through more complex purchasing decisions, often involving project planning and installation considerations. The Home Depot in Tooele likely seeks individuals with demonstrable experience in these specific areas.

  • Cashier

    Cashiers are responsible for efficiently and accurately processing customer transactions at the point of sale. This role requires attention to detail, strong communication skills, and the ability to handle cash and other forms of payment. While seemingly straightforward, a positive interaction with a cashier can significantly impact a customer’s overall impression of the store in Tooele.

  • Merchandising Associate

    Merchandising Associates are tasked with maintaining the visual appeal and organization of the store’s displays and shelves. This involves stocking products, implementing planograms, and ensuring that merchandise is presented in an attractive and accessible manner. Efficient merchandising directly impacts sales and enhances the shopping experience for customers in Tooele.

  • Customer Service Associate

    Customer Service Associates are responsible for addressing customer inquiries, resolving complaints, and processing returns and exchanges. These individuals act as the primary point of contact for customers seeking assistance, requiring a deep understanding of store policies and procedures. For example, a customer seeking to return a defective product in Tooele would interact with a Customer Service Associate to facilitate the return and receive a refund or exchange. Effectively handling such situations directly contributes to customer retention and positive word-of-mouth.

  • Pro Desk Associate

    Pro Desk Associates provide specialized support to professional contractors and tradespeople. This role demands a thorough understanding of construction materials, project planning, and volume purchasing. A contractor in Tooele might rely on a Pro Desk Associate to source specific materials, obtain bulk discounts, and arrange for delivery to a job site. Expertise in this area is essential for catering to the needs of professional customers and securing their continued business.

  • Phone Support Representative

    Phone Support Representatives handle customer inquiries received via telephone, providing information, troubleshooting issues, and directing customers to the appropriate departments. This role requires excellent communication skills and the ability to quickly assess customer needs remotely. For instance, a Tooele resident calling with questions about product availability or store hours would interact with a Phone Support Representative. Their ability to provide accurate and efficient assistance contributes to the overall customer experience.

  • Lot Associate

    While not traditionally categorized, Lot Associates contribute to customer service by assisting with loading purchases, retrieving carts, and maintaining the cleanliness of the parking area. This role provides a first and last impression for many customers. Imagine a customer purchasing lumber in Tooele; the Lot Associate’s assistance with loading the lumber into their vehicle significantly enhances their shopping experience. Their visibility and helpfulness contribute to a welcoming and organized store environment.

Question 1: What types of positions are commonly available at the Tooele Home Depot?

Common positions include sales associates, cashiers, customer service representatives, warehouse staff, and management roles. Specific availability varies based on current staffing needs and can be found on the Home Depot’s careers website.

Question 2: What are the typical requirements for entry-level positions?

Entry-level positions typically require a high school diploma or equivalent. Prior retail or customer service experience may be preferred, but is not always required. A willingness to learn and a strong work ethic are generally valued.

Question 3: Where can applications be submitted for positions at the Tooele location?

Applications are generally submitted online through the Home Depot’s careers website. The website allows filtering by location and job category. Direct applications in-store may also be possible but are not typically the primary method.

Question 4: What benefits are offered to employees at the Home Depot?

Benefits packages for eligible employees may include health insurance, dental insurance, vision insurance, paid time off, 401(k) retirement plans, and employee stock purchase plans. Specific benefit eligibility requirements may apply.

Question 5: Does the Home Depot offer opportunities for career advancement?

The Home Depot typically provides career advancement opportunities, with internal promotion being a common practice. Employees may progress from entry-level positions to leadership roles through training, experience, and demonstrated performance.

Tips

This section provides guidance for individuals seeking employment at the Home Depot location in Tooele, Utah. These tips focus on maximizing application effectiveness and interview preparedness.

Tip 1: Tailor Application Materials. Align resume and cover letter content with specific job descriptions. Highlight relevant skills and experience directly applicable to the targeted position.

Tip 2: Research the Company and its Culture. Demonstrable knowledge of the Home Depot’s values, mission, and products is advantageous. Understand the company’s focus on customer service and its commitment to community involvement.

Tip 3: Emphasize Customer Service Skills. Positions at the Home Depot, regardless of department, require interaction with customers. Provide examples of positive customer service experiences in previous roles.

Tip 4: Prepare for Behavioral Interview Questions. Anticipate questions related to problem-solving, teamwork, and handling difficult situations.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ure responses.

Tip 5: Dress Professionally for the Interview. Even for entry-level positions, appropriate attire conveys seriousness and respect. Business casual attire is generally recommended.

Tip 6: Arrive on Time and Prepared. Punctuality demonstrates reliability. Bring extra copies of resume and any relevant certifications. Prepare thoughtful questions to ask the interviewer.

Tip 7: Follow Up After the Interview. Sending a thank-you note or email within 24 hours reinforces interest and professionalism. Briefly reiterate key qualifications and express continued enthusiasm for the opportunity.
